GTS Translation is a cloud-based translation management system that helps businesses manage multilingual content. It provides features like translation memory, machine translation, terminology management, and workflow automation.
Gengo is a translation API that allows developers to easily integrate translation into their applications and websites. It provides access to a network of human translators that can translate between over 140 language pairs.
